Understanding Katana and Tachi Difference
Two types of Japanese Katana, or a tachi (top) and a uchigatana (bottom) – (Image Credit – SwordIs)
Katanas and tachis are famous two-handed Japanese swords seen all over modern media, especially in anime. “Katana” means “sword” in Japanese and can refer to any type of single-edged blade used with both hands.
Tachi sabers are older and feature a much stronger curve, designed for use on horseback. They are worn with the sharp edge facing down, or the traditional style while the sword hangs off the user?s belt.
